Transaction 689e6889681d491a744c77da325b15561b9b74135a2902bd9dc88a7a07e89337
1 Input
1 Output
-
689e6889681d491a744c77da325b15561b9b74135a2902bd9dc88a7a07e89337:0
- value
- 27834577
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 75a6059d030f7570313155311a29038f9ded2201 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bj4wrHzun9YpzQ7TeNgKJJWo7cyQJqPFA